Role of microRNAs and their downstream target transcription factors in zebrafish thrombopoiesis
Abstract Previous studies have shown that human platelets and megakaryocytes carry microRNAs suggesting their role in platelet function and megakaryocyte development, respectively. However, a comprehensive study on the microRNAs and their targets has not been undertaken. Zebrafish thrombocytes could...
